High-Stakes Gameplay

Dark Souls is a game that punishes failure. When you die, you lose all your accumulated souls, and you have to start over from the last checkpoint. This high-stakes gameplay creates a sense of tension and anxiety, making it even more challenging to progress through the game.

Lack of Guidance

Dark Souls does not provide much guidance or direction. You are left to your own devices to figure out what to do and where to go. This can be frustrating, as you may have to spend hours exploring and searching for clues.
